Output 666398a344a9808fa8050dc12604a321d01e6eb1618d69272e77f571cfba80ef:1

value
585000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ecf06d0722fb5b3d5bfaacf400d8c55f1fb572bc OP_EQUALVERIFY OP_CHECKSIG
address
1NbpVMdXeaF7VxUUyN6tvbpZnEYeGssR1b
transaction
666398a344a9808fa8050dc12604a321d01e6eb1618d69272e77f571cfba80ef
spent
true